Nagelsmann Plans Squad Rotation Ahead of Ghana Friendly

Nagelsmann Plans Squad Rotation Ahead of Ghana Friendly

Germany head coach Julian Nagelsmann says he will refresh his lineup for Monday’s friendly against the Black Stars of Ghana. He wants to manage workloads and give minutes to players returning from injury. Stuttgart keeper Alexander Nubel and forward Deniz Undav are both assured of playing time. Germany come into this match off a hard-fought 4-3 win over Switzerland. Nagelsmann stressed the need to keep his squad fit for the run-in at club level and for the upcoming World Cup. He also made it clear that every player knows where they stand in his plans. “Not every player will be happy in the end,” he admitted. “But two months before the World Cup, clarity is crucial.”
